Methodology

How Banking CX Pulse scores are calculated.

Transparent formulas for NPS, CSAT, Ease, Trust, Complaint Resolution, and the weighted CX Pulse Score — with sample-size rules that protect credibility.

Scoring logic

NPS equals the percentage of promoters minus the percentage of detractors. Scores of 9–10 are promoters, 7–8 are passives, and 0–6 are detractors.

CSAT is the percentage of satisfied and very satisfied responses. Ease is the percentage of easy and very easy responses. Trust is the percentage of completely-trust and mostly-trust responses.

Complaint Resolution is the percentage of complaint cases marked fully resolved. Partial resolution is tracked separately.

CX Pulse Score

NPS is normalised from its −100…+100 range onto a 0–100 scale. The overall index applies this weighting: NPS 25%, CSAT 25%, Ease 20%, Trust 20%, Complaint Resolution 10%.

Why four metrics, not one

NPS measures advocacy, CSAT captures satisfaction with a specific experience, CES diagnoses friction, and Trust captures institutional confidence — a dimension unique to financial services. Using all four avoids the well-documented gap between reported loyalty and actual customer behaviour.

Sample-size policy

Institutions with fewer than 100 valid responses display “Insufficient sample size for public ranking.” This protects against reputational damage from statistically unreliable scores. All published scores show their sample count (n=).

Privacy

Privacy Policy & Survey Consent Notice

Banking CX Pulse™ operates under Nigeria's Data Protection Act (NDPA) 2023.

Banking CX Pulse™ is designed with data minimisation in mind. The survey does not request account numbers, BVN, NIN, PIN, OTP, passwords, full card numbers, CVV, transaction passwords, banking credentials, document uploads, or staff names for public display.

All survey data is collected with explicit informed consent. Optional contact details (name, email, phone) are collected only when a respondent agrees to be contacted, are stored separately from survey responses, and are never shown on the public dashboard or shared with banks without consent.

Comments may be scanned for sensitive terms and patterns. Responses containing possible sensitive data are flagged for admin review before any public use. Respondents may request deletion of their data at any time, and raw responses are retained for 24 months.

Aggregated, anonymised scores may be used for customer experience research, reporting, service-improvement insights, industry benchmarks, and Skimatik advisory conversations.

Data protection responsibilities

Skimatik Concepts is the data controller for all data collected through Banking CX Pulse™ and is accountable under the Nigeria Data Protection Act (NDPA) 2023 for lawful collection, consent, secure storage, retention, and honouring your rights. Our data-protection lead, Benjamin Nwoye, is PrivacyOps Academy Certified (Securiti) in data privacy laws, concepts, and privacy operations. Data-protection queries and requests go to Contact@Skimatikconcepts.com (subject line “Data Protection”) and are acknowledged within 72 hours and resolved within 30 days.

Service providers acting as data processors (database hosting, bot protection, payments, AI comment analysis) process data only on Skimatik's instructions under contract terms; open comments have personal identifiers stripped before any automated analysis.

Subscribing banks and fintechs receive aggregated, anonymised intelligence only. They are never given raw responses, contact details, or another institution's data, and may not attempt to re-identify respondents.

Your rights as a respondent

  • Access — ask what data we hold about your submission.
  • Correction — have inaccurate contact details corrected.
  • Deletion — request removal of your response and contact data at any time.
  • Withdraw consent — opt out of follow-up contact at any time, without affecting your submitted rating.
  • Complain — escalate to the Nigeria Data Protection Commission (NDPC) if unsatisfied with our response.

If we ever suffer a breach affecting personal data, we will notify the NDPC within 72 hours of becoming aware of it and inform affected respondents where there is likely risk to them.
